Q: Is 544,467 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 544,467 is a composite number.

Why is 544,467 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 544,467 can be evenly divided by 1 3 7 11 21 33 77 231 2,357 7,071 16,499 25,927 49,497 77,781 181,489 and 544,467, with no remainder.

Since 544,467 cannot be divided by just 1 and 544,467, it is a composite number.
